How The Dometic RV Furnace Works

Understanding the basic operation helps troubleshoot efficiently. The Dometic furnace uses propane combustion to heat a heat exchanger while a fan circulates air through the RV ductwork. Key components include the thermostat, control board, igniter or spark assembly, gas valve, burner assembly, heat exchanger, blower motor, limit switch, and exhaust flue.

Why This Matters: Problems arise when any of those systems fail or when airflow or fuel supply is inadequate. Systematic checks reduce unnecessary parts replacement and improve safety.

Safety First: Precautions Before Troubleshooting

Always prioritize safety when working with propane and electrical systems. Turn off propane at the tank before inspecting the gas circuit. Disconnect battery power when performing electrical diagnostics that require exposed wiring. Work in a well-ventilated area and keep a fire extinguisher rated for gas fires nearby.

Important: If there is any strong propane smell, stop and ventilate immediately. Do not attempt repairs beyond basic diagnostics if unsure; consult a certified RV technician.

Initial Diagnostic Checklist

Start with simple checks that often resolve common faults. These steps minimize time and expense before deeper troubleshooting.

  • Verify the thermostat is set to heat and above ambient temperature.
  • Check RV battery voltage; many furnaces require 12V for control and ignition.
  • Inspect inline fuse and furnace fuse on the control board.
  • Confirm propane supply and that the tank valve and regulator are open and functioning.
  • Ensure vents and intake/exhaust flues are unobstructed and free of debris or nests.

No Power, No Display, Or Control Board Dead

If the furnace control panel is dark or the unit does not attempt to start, the issue is usually electrical.

Steps To Diagnose

  • Check the RV house battery voltage; below ~11.5V the furnace may not function reliably.
  • Locate and inspect the furnace inline fuse and the vehicle’s fused distribution panel for a blown fuse.
  • Ensure wiring harness connections at the furnace are secure and free of corrosion.
  • Test for 12V at the furnace control board input using a multimeter; if absent, trace back to the fuse or battery disconnects.

Common Fixes

  • Replace blown fuses with the correct rating. Do not bypass fuses.
  • Tighten or clean battery and harness terminals. Apply dielectric grease to prevent corrosion.
  • Replace a failed control board only after verifying power is present and other faults cleared.

Ignition Clicks But Furnace Won’t Light

Frequent clicking indicates the igniter is attempting to light but combustion does not occur. Causes include clogged burner ports, a defective igniter, or fuel supply issues.

Inspection And Cleaning

  • Turn off propane and power to the furnace. Remove the access panel to expose the burner assembly.
  • Visually inspect burner ports for soot, spider webs, rust, or debris. Clean with a soft brush and compressed air.
  • Check the igniter electrode position and condition; it should be intact and positioned according to the service manual.

Fuel System Checks

  • Verify propane at the tank and that the service valve and regulator are open and delivering pressure.
  • Smell test for leaks with a solution of soapy water; never use open flame. If bubbles appear at fittings, tighten or replace components.
  • Inspect the gas valve and orifice for obstruction; replace if damaged or clogged.

Furnace Starts Then Shuts Off Quickly

If the furnace runs momentarily then shuts down, common causes are safety interlocks like the limit switch or issues with the thermostat signal.

Airflow And Exhaust Checks

  • Blocked intake or exhaust will cause overheating and shutdown. Clear snow, dirt, or nests from intake and flue.
  • Check the furnace air filter and duct vents inside the RV; restricted airflow forces the limit switch to open.

Limit Switch And Overheat Diagnostics

  • Inspect the limit switch wiring and continuity with a multimeter. Replace if intermittent or failed.
  • Ensure the blower motor is running; if the blower fails, the furnace will overheat and shut off.

Blower Runs But No Heat

A blower that runs without heat often points to a combustion problem: no ignition or because the gas valve is not opening.

Gas Valve And Pressure

  • Test voltage to the gas valve during a start attempt. If voltage is present but no valve activation, the valve may be defective.
  • Have propane pressure measured at the regulator; inadequate pressure due to regulator failure or empty tanks prevents proper combustion.

Heat Exchanger And Burner Condition

  • A damaged heat exchanger can prevent heat transfer or allow leak paths. Inspect for cracks or corrosion and replace if compromised.
  • Clean the burner thoroughly and verify the pilot or ignition sequence is correct per the Dometic manual.

Error Codes And Diagnostic Lights

Many Dometic furnaces provide diagnostic LED flashes or control board codes to indicate specific faults. Consult the furnace manual for the specific model code chart.

  • Count the number of flashes and check whether they repeat in sequences; each pattern maps to a fault like high limit, ignition failure, or blower problem.
  • Record codes and symptoms before attempting resets. Clearing errors without resolving the cause may mask a dangerous condition.

Regular Maintenance To Prevent Problems

Routine maintenance dramatically reduces furnace failures and extends service life. A seasonal checklist helps ensure reliability.

  • Clean burner assembly and heat exchanger annually or every season of heavy use.
  • Inspect and clean intake and exhaust vents before winter; install screens to reduce nesting.
  • Check thermostat calibration and replace batteries in digital thermostats if used.
  • Test blower motor and lubricate bearings if applicable, following manufacturer guidance.
  • Have propane system pressure and regulator function checked during routine RV service.

When To Replace Parts Versus Service

Deciding between component replacement and professional service depends on symptoms and technical skills. Minor items like fuses, thermostats, or easily accessible igniters can be replaced by a competent owner.

Replace parts that are visibly damaged, corroded, or fail continuity testing. Seek professional service for gas valve replacement, heat exchanger cracks, or control board diagnostics beyond basic checks.

Finding Parts And Professional Help

Use the furnace model number from the data plate to order exact replacement parts like igniters, thermostats, blower motors, and control boards. OEM Dometic parts ensure compatibility and safety.

Authorized RV service centers or certified propane technicians should handle gas valve, regulator, or heat exchanger repairs. Many RV dealers and mobile RV techs perform on-site diagnostics and repairs for convenience.

Frequently Asked Questions

How Often Should The Furnace Be Serviced?

Annual servicing is recommended before the heating season. Frequent use in cold climates may require mid-season inspections. Regular checks minimize the risk of mid-trip failures.

Can An Owner Replace The Igniter Or Flame Sensor?

Yes, owners with basic mechanical skills can replace igniters or flame sensors. Follow the manufacturer instructions, disconnect power and propane, and use correct OEM parts for safety and performance.

Is It Safe To Run The Furnace While Driving?

Many RV owners run the furnace while traveling, but ensure vents remain clear and carbon monoxide detectors are functional. Confirm the furnace model supports operation while in motion according to the owner’s manual.

Will Carbon Monoxide Detectors Protect Against Furnace Issues?

Carbon monoxide detectors are essential but not a substitute for proper furnace maintenance. They provide a critical early warning; test detectors monthly and replace batteries as recommended.
